# PKPaymentButtonStyle.whiteOutline

A white button with black lettering and a black outline.

```
case whiteOutline
```

## Discussion

Use the white button with black outline on white or very light backgrounds that don’t provide sufficient contrast for a plain white button. Don’t place this button on dark or saturated color backgrounds. Use the white button instead.

In many cases, you can choose either the white button with black outline or the black button. Select the button that works best with your user interface. Always use a single style throughout your app.
